There are some very good suggestions here, however it appears from your post that you already have the model built and flown. If you constructed the Amraam 4 without dual deployment, that means you epoxied the coupler into the upper bodytube. This will make it more difficult to incorporate, but not impossible. Please note that with the following suggestion, you only need to modify the coupler bulkhead plate...no additional tubes need added and the original coupler can remain in place.
I would suggest cutting a 2.1" hole in the bulkhead at the end of the coupler, which is glued to the upper body tube. You can use another CR to overlay it and draw the hole. This will convert the bulkhead into a centering ring with a 2.1" center hole. Next, you can glue an internal centering ring at the top of the coupler...a 3.9" to 2.1" coupler CR could be used. Then I would glue a piece of 2.1" body tube to "link" the two CR's. If you wish, you can glue a Piston strap to the side of the 2.1" tube and have it protrude out the top of the rocket so you can connect a piston.
All that remains is to build a Alt bay. A 2.1" coupler can be used with a 2.1" bulkhead plate at the upper end and a 3.9" bulkhead plate at the lower end. You can attach a eyebolt to the bottom 3.9" plate(to replace the original you cut out) along with a cheap BP canister made from PVC or copper tubing. A board can be built to slide inside the 2" Alt bay and two all thread rods running the length of the bay along the sides can bolt the end caps together.A PVC or Copper ejection canister can be bolted to the top 2" plate and with the unit assembled, it inserts into the 3.9" coupler and bolts in place.
I would use a couple 8-32 or 1/4-20 T-nuts inside the lower lip of the original bulkhead, which is now a coupler. This can be used to bolt the alt bay in place. I have attached a couple pics of similar bays I have built below.
